Director of Engineering

Manchester, England, United Kingdom

Job summary

The Engineering Director will report into the Regional CEO of Metroline Manchester on the day-to-day activities within the engineering function of the business. Work closely with operations and service delivery colleagues to provide sufficient vehicles to operate the contracted services, ensuring good financial control of budget, and alignment with group quality and safety requirements, focusing on efficiencies within the engineering team and systems, using data to drive decision making.

Main Responsibilities

Ensuring compliance regarding the undertakings detailed in the company O Licence, as one of the two senior Transport managers on the licence (with Service Delivery Director) Responsible for all amendments, additions, and changes.

Identified as point of contact for the company O licence with both the local DVSA operation and the Office of the Traffic Commissioners in the North West.

Acting as the initial point of contact and interface with all vehicle and major component suppliers with regard to technical or vehicle support issues, liaising with the Metroline Technical team on common problems, campaigns, warranty issues, bulletins etc.

Working with the procurement team to coordinate the implementation of national and local technical support contracts and service agreements.

Maintaining an overview of all maintenance procedures and programmes within depot workshops.

Monitoring engineering standards and promoting engineering excellence.

Working with the Engineering management to deliver cost effective repairs and to highlight areas of change required to increase efficiency.

Oversee close financial control and ensure garage engineering outputs are achieved within Budget.

Responsible for monitoring the vehicle cleaning standards in line with TfGM standards along with depot premises, plant, tools and equipment to ensure these are kept at an appropriate standard commensurate with H&S requirements.

Working with HR and training providers to maintain staff levels and skills across all sites, recruit suitable trainees and develop links within the community to promote the benefits of Engineering trades.

Working with the Group Engineering Director for Metroline to ensure KPI & budget compliance with both the local Manchester market and the wider Group strategies and aims.

Working with the Financial & Commercial Director and Facilities manager, in all aspects of Metroline Manchester property portfolio including liaison with legal firms, landlords and other authorities as necessary to maintain operations at all sites and compliance with all legal and contractual arrangements as laid down under English Law.

Provide key assistance as required on all major property re-development and infrastructure matters.

Promote awareness and ensure the implementation of all mandatory Health, Safety and environmental procedures and legislation through training, mentoring and discipline.

The duties listed above are not exhaustive.
